I have a function that will parse some data coming in. My problem is that after using strncpy I get some garbage when I try to print it. I try using malloc to make the char array the exact size.
Code:
void parse_data(char *unparsed_data)
{
char *temp_str;
char *pos;
char *pos2;
char *key;
char *data;
const char newline = '\n';
int timestamp = 0;
temp_str = (char*)malloc(strlen(unparsed_data));
g_print("\nThe original string is: \n%s\n",unparsed_data);
//Ignore the first two lines
pos = strchr(unparsed_data, newline);
strcpy(temp_str, pos+1);
pos = strchr(temp_str, newline);
strcpy(temp_str, pos+1);
//Split the line in two; The key name and the value
pos = strchr(temp_str, ':'); // ':' divides the name from the value
pos2 = strchr(temp_str, '\n'); //end of the line
key = (char*)malloc((size_t)(pos-temp_str)-1); //allocate enough memory
data = (char*)malloc((size_t)(pos2-pos)-1);
strncpy(key, temp_str, (size_t)(pos-temp_str));
strncpy(data, pos + 2, (size_t)(pos2-pos));
timestamp = atoi(data);
g_print("size of the variable \"key\" = %d or %d\n", (size_t)(pos-temp_str), strlen(key));
g_print("size of the variable \"data\" = %d or %d\n", (size_t)(pos2-pos), strlen(data));
g_print("The key name is %s\n",key);
g_print("The value is %s\n",data);
g_print("End of Parser\n");
}

Your
strncpy(data, pos + 2, (size_t)(pos2-pos));doesn’t add a terminating\0character at the end of the string. Therefore when you try to print it later,printf()prints your whole data string and whatever is in the memory right after it, until it reaches zero – that’s the garbate you’re getting. You need to explicitly append zero at the end of your data. It’s also needed foratoi().Edit:
You need to allocate one more byte for your
data, and write a terminating character there.data[len_of_data] = '\0'. Only after that it becomes a valid C string and you can use it foratoi()andprintf().
